NCSU Chairman, Sanyaolu Congratulates Twenty Newly Inaugurated Chairmen, Councillors Charges Them To Be Productive

The Comrade Sanyaolu Oladipupo Ismail State Chairman, Nigeria Civil Service Union, has congratulated the newly elected chairmen and councillors of the 20 local government councils, following official announcement of Sunday’s council election results by the State Independent Electoral Commission.

The Chairman of Nigeria Civil Service Union, NCSU, Sanyaolu in a statement made available to Amebo Newspaper NG expressed satisfaction at the conduct of the election. He lauded the professionalism of the OGSIEC officials under the leadership of Barr Osibodu, saying that the hitch-free nature of the election was a reflection of their professional conduct.



Sanyaolu said he was particularly impressed the election held under a peaceful atmosphere as voters and OGSIEC officials conducted themselves in orderly manners.

While congratulating the newly elected council chiefs, the Chairman urged them to see their election as a call to serve, adding that they cannot afford to disappoint those who voted for them.

The Chairman said : “I congratulate the good people of Ogun State, for demonstrating their peaceful nature and love for democracy during Saturday’s council poll. The professionalism of OGSIEC under the leadership of Barr Osibodu is also commendable.



“I also congratulate and welcome on board all our newly elected chairmen and councillors. I urge them to see their election as a call to serve and should do their best not to disappoint the people that voted for them.

“They should be guided by the fact that our administration of Prince Dapo Abiodun has zero tolerance for corruption , and it is certainly not going to be business as usual in our councils this time around," the statement added.
